McDowell, Eric L. – Mathematics Teacher, 2016
By the time they reach middle school, all students have been taught to add fractions. However, not all have "learned" to add fractions. The common mistake in adding fractions is to report that a/b + c/d is equal to (a + c)/(b + d). It is certainly necessary to correct this mistake when a student makes it. However, this occasion also…

Peer reviewedRuais, Ronald W. – Mathematics Teacher, 1978
An algorithm is given for the addition and subtraction of fractions based on dividing the sum of diagonal numerator and denominator products by the product of the denominators. As an explanation of the teaching method, activities used in teaching are demonstrated. (MN)

Peer reviewedKolpas, Sidney J.; Massion, Gary R. – Mathematics Teacher, 2000
Introduces a toy, the Educated Monkey, developed to help students learn multiplication tables and associated division, factoring, and addition tables and associated subtraction. Explains why the monkey works and reviews geometric, algebraic, and arithmetic concepts. (KHR)

Peer reviewedHoward, Arthur C. – Mathematics Teacher, 1991
Discussed is why students have the tendency to apply an "add the numerators and add the denominators" approach to adding fractions. Suggested is providing examples exemplifying this intuitive approach from ratio, concentration, and distance problems to demonstrate under what conditions it is applicable in contrast to the addition algorithm.
